If You Like Puzzles, Try Some of Ours . . .

Many Mensans love to tackle mental puzzles like the ones below. Some you may find easy, others you may not. If you can solve them, you might be one of the five million Americans eligible for Mensa.

Not all questions would be found on an IQ test. The answer to some may represent acquired knowledge in a specific area.
